Transaction 75fe7e18fd7cfc630dbb509dac06fa6ce9c8bd8ea8856cb7e2142c218e8f136c

1 Input
2 Outputs
  • 75fe7e18fd7cfc630dbb509dac06fa6ce9c8bd8ea8856cb7e2142c218e8f136c:0
  • value  148219618
    address  3Hst1YjuVZ7PnP8o4hoskcp5fYquMZ9GXA
  • 75fe7e18fd7cfc630dbb509dac06fa6ce9c8bd8ea8856cb7e2142c218e8f136c:1
  • value  670000
    address  1Aa7xk8q1x3DugzAC9iJp2TtwUuwKKc6rQ